Niger Delta Frontline leader Pa, Chief Edwin Clark, passes away at age of 97.

Niger Delta Frontline leader Pa, Chief Edwin Clark, passes away at age of 97. EgbemaVoice, Abuja Renowned Niger Delta leader and former Chairman of the Pan Niger Delta Forum (PANDEF), Chief Edwin Clark, has passed away at the age of 97. His family announced his demise in a statement signed by Prof. C.C. Clark and Mr. Penawei Clark, confirming that the elder statesman died on February 17, 2025. They expressed gratitude for the public's prayers and support, adding that further details would be communicated in due course. Chief Edwin Clark was a distinguished Ijaw national leader, a former Federal Commissioner for Information, and a relentless advocate for the rights and development of the Niger Delta region. Throughout his life, he championed the cause of his people and left an indelible mark on Nigeria's political landscape. His passing marks the end of an era, leaving behind a legacy of leadership and unwavering dedication to justice and equity for the Niger Delta.
